Is Saudi Arabia’s $500B Dream Dead? Plus: The $5.4B Robotics Deal That Changes Everything

In this episode of Bricks, Bucks & Bytes, Owen, Martin, and Patric dive into the biggest construction and tech stories shaking up the industry right now.

What we cover:

  • NEOM’s collapse – Why Saudi Arabia is pulling the plug on “The Line” and what it means for construction startups in the region (spoiler: 21,000 workers died building this dream)
  • SoftBank’s massive $5.4B bet – Breaking down the ABB Robotics acquisition and what “physical AI” really means for construction
  • The humanoid vs. specialized robots debate – Which will actually take over construction sites first?
  • Calvin from CrewScope on using gamification to boost worker productivity (yes, leaderboards for drywallers are real)
  • NK from Track3D reveals how they raised $10M to turn reality capture data into instant project insights – no BIM model required
  • The AI circus continues – From OpenAI “killing 1000 startups” to Nvidia’s brilliant financing scheme with xAI

Key quote: “People have been trying solutions for so long. I don’t think it’s on the industry – they’ve been trying. It’s on us as technology providers. Our technology is not simple enough.” – NK Chaitanya, Track3D
